    Terrible customer service. I needed a toll free number for my business needs and registered an account at tollfreeforwarding.com. I've started giving this number to my clients. Later i got an e-mail saying my phone number was suspended, i've contacted their customer support and they said that they've suspended my account because my location changed(i use dotvpn browser extension). They've asked me to send them a copy of my id and my credit card, and i did that. That wasn't enough though, they wanted me to print a form, fill it in by hand, take a picture of it and send it to them. Yeah... no. I've already started using another service, and i'm still getting e-mails from them...

    I have ordered a number of phone numbers of Toll Free Forwarding and half the time they do not connect or forward to the phone number requested - poor lines.

    On a few times, I have bought a number only to realise it is a 2nd hand number  i.e. some company was using it before and in some cases still had it listed on website - why are tff still selling old 2nd hand phone numbers?

    The worst strike against TFF is they charge your card what they like?  I owed less then $400 in one instance and they charged my card $880?????? I had to take the card down from their site.

    Their customer service is just awful, I can actually say probably the worst company I've ever dealt with.....
